Output 65622b67fec73215dd316b397a934875291f91c3a54e0e901d3ff315f199e17c:3

value
344514
script pubkey
OP_0 OP_PUSHBYTES_20 ae8b5c2a6f04aaa9b8c92a3ef1ea605786dbf549
address
bc1q4694c2n0qj42nwxf9gl0r6nq27rdha2f9sdw5k
transaction
65622b67fec73215dd316b397a934875291f91c3a54e0e901d3ff315f199e17c
spent
true